Green lid Bin (Trash)
Trash must be securely tied in plastic bags and placed inside the cart. The lid must close properly. Set out by 7:00 a.m. on collection day with a 3-foot clearance on all sides.

Yellow lid Bin (Recycling)
Recyclables must fit inside the cart with the lid closed. Items do not have to be bagged (loose is best, but clear bags are acceptable). Containers should be rinsed free of food.
Accepted Items
- ✓Chipboard, boxboard, and cardboard
- ✓Tin and aluminum cans
- ✓Plastic bottles, jars, jugs, cups, and tubs
- ✓Glass bottles and jars
- ✓Junk mail, office paper, and magazines
Do NOT Include
- ✕Food waste and liquids
- ✕Plastic wraps or bags
- ✕Foam products (Styrofoam)
- ✕Hazardous waste

Bulky Item Pickup
Frequency
Once per month on your designated collection week.
Placement
Place items at the front curb (even if you have an alley) by 7:00 a.m. on Monday. Items may be placed out as early as the Friday before your collection week.
Accepted
- ✓ Appliances (refrigerators/freezers must have Freon removed)
- ✓ Furniture
- ✓ Fence sections
- ✓ Bags of leaves
- ✓ Large residential items
Not Accepted
- ✕ Commercial waste
- ✕ Hazardous waste and chemicals
- ✕ Electronics
- ✕ Piles exceeding 10 cubic yards
Up to 10 cubic yards is included at no extra charge. For construction trash or overages, residents can use their free quarterly access to the WM landfill in Ferris for up to 3 cubic yards.
Holiday Schedule
General Rule
If a holiday falls on a weekday, collections for the rest of the week will be pushed back a day (e.g., Thursday service moves to Friday). For holidays on Saturday or Sunday, there are no delays.
Yard Waste Exception
Monthly bulk and brush collections scheduled during a holiday week will experience the same one-day delay as regular household garbage routes.

!Contamination Tips
Bag Your Trash, Not Your Recycling
Place all household garbage in securely tied plastic bags before tossing them in your green-lidded cart. For your yellow-lidded recycling cart, place items completely loose, as standard opaque plastic bags will jam the sorting facility's equipment.
Keep Materials Inside the Carts
Waste Management's automated trucks will only service materials properly placed inside the provided carts with the lids fully closed. Any loose trash bags, broken down cardboard, or excess debris left on top of or beside the carts will be ignored.
Don't Mix Hazardous Waste
Never place wet paint, motor oil, batteries, or old electronics in either of your curbside carts or your monthly bulk pile. Utilize the convenient At-Your-Door Special Collection program instead to ensure these items are handled safely.

About Cedar Hill Waste Management
Automated Cart Collection System
Cedar Hill partners with Waste Management to provide once-a-week automated trash and recycling services. Residents are issued two 96-gallon carts—one with a green lid for household garbage and one with a yellow lid for recyclables. Because the trucks use mechanical arms, carts must have at least three feet of clearance on all sides and be kept five feet away from cars and mailboxes.
Monthly 10-Cubic-Yard Bulk and Brush Allowance
You don't need to call ahead for standard bulky item disposal in Cedar Hill. Bulk and brush items are collected together in a single pile once per month. Residents can set out up to 10 cubic yards of acceptable materials—like old furniture, bagged leaves, and fence sections—by 7:00 a.m. on the Monday of their assigned collection week.
At-Your-Door Special Collection for Hazardous Waste
Properly disposing of electronics and household chemicals is incredibly easy for Cedar Hill residents. Instead of waiting for a bi-annual drop-off event, you can utilize the At-Your-Door Special Collection Service. Simply request a pickup online or by phone, and WM will mail you a collection kit to safely pack your hazardous materials for a convenient front-porch pickup.
Free Quarterly Landfill Access
If you generate heavy construction debris or have a massive cleanout that exceeds the monthly 10-cubic-yard bulk limit, the city offers a free alternative. Cedar Hill residents can visit the Waste Management landfill in Ferris, Texas, once a quarter at no cost. You can drop off up to 3 cubic yards of fencing, brush, or construction trash by presenting your driver's license and a matching utility bill.

Frequently Asked Questions
What should I do if my garbage or recycling cart is damaged?
If your green or yellow-lidded cart is damaged or missing a wheel, you can request a cart repair or replacement by calling the Cedar Hill Customer Service Department at 469-272-2931. You can also submit a repair request online via the city's Cart Store portal.
Can I throw old paint or batteries in my trash cart?
No, household hazardous waste cannot go in your curbside carts. Cedar Hill residents can use the At-Your-Door Special Collection service. Simply visit www.cedarhilltx.com/AYD or call 800-449-7587 to schedule a home pickup, and a technician will collect the items from your front door.
How much bulk trash and brush can I put out each month?
You can set out a combined pile of bulk items and brush up to 10 cubic yards once a month. Items must be placed at the front curb (even if your normal trash is collected in an alley) by 7:00 a.m. on the Monday of your scheduled collection week.
Does Cedar Hill accept glass in the recycling cart?
Yes, glass bottles and jars are perfectly acceptable in your yellow-lidded recycling cart. Please ensure they are empty and rinsed free of food residue before tossing them in.
